What is a Massage Therapy Intake Form?

The Massage Therapy Intake Form is a crucial document required by UAE healthcare authorities for all massage therapy services provided within the country. This form must be completed before any massage therapy treatment can commence, in accordance with UAE Federal Law No. 2 of 2019 regarding healthcare data management and relevant Department of Health regulations. The document serves multiple purposes: gathering essential client information, documenting medical history, obtaining informed consent, and ensuring compliance with UAE healthcare documentation standards. It's designed to protect both the service provider and client while facilitating appropriate treatment planning. The form must be maintained as part of the client's medical record and updated regularly as per local healthcare facility requirements.

About the Massage Therapy Intake Form

A Massage Therapy Intake Form is your essential first step when seeking professional massage therapy services in the United Arab Emirates. This comprehensive document ensures that your treatment is both safe and legally compliant with UAE healthcare regulations, while providing your therapist with crucial information needed to deliver appropriate care.

When do you need this document?

You'll need to complete a Massage Therapy Intake Form before your first appointment at any licensed massage therapy facility in the UAE. This includes wellness centers in Dubai Healthcare City, Abu Dhabi's complementary medicine clinics, spa facilities offering therapeutic massage, and independent massage therapy practices. The form is also required when switching therapists within the same facility, returning after a significant health change, or when your previous intake form expires according to facility policies. Insurance providers may also request this documentation when processing claims for covered massage therapy treatments.

Key legal considerations

Your intake form serves as both a medical document and legal protection under UAE law. The personal information section must include your complete details as they appear on your Emirates ID, ensuring accurate identification and compliance with UAE healthcare documentation standards. Medical history disclosures are crucial for liability protection – failing to disclose relevant health conditions could void insurance coverage and expose you to treatment risks. The informed consent section legally acknowledges that you understand the treatment risks and benefits, protecting both you and your therapist. Emergency contact information ensures rapid response capabilities as required by UAE healthcare facility standards. Data protection clauses must comply with UAE Federal Law No. 2 of 2019, guaranteeing your health information remains confidential and secure.

Legal requirements in United Arab Emirates

UAE Federal Law No. 2 of 2019 mandates specific data collection and protection standards for all healthcare-related documentation, including massage therapy intake forms. In Dubai Healthcare City, DHCC Regulation No. 2 of 2013 requires comprehensive patient documentation for all complementary and alternative medicine practices. Abu Dhabi facilities must comply with Department of Health standards that specify minimum information requirements and record retention periods. The UAE Medical Liability Law No. 7 of 1975 establishes professional standards that make proper intake documentation essential for legal protection. Your completed form must be stored securely for the duration specified by your emirate's health authority, typically ranging from five to seven years. Arabic translation services must be available for non-English speaking clients, and forms must accommodate cultural sensitivities regarding personal information disclosure in accordance with local customs and Islamic principles.
